I’m working on a ballast racking project that has a ballasted roof (river rocks on the roof).   The roof can not support the addition of cement blocks so I am planning to use the river rocks that are already on the roof as the solar ballast.    I have done this before using the SolarDock racking system as it fully encloses the ballast in a tray which keeps the rocks in place.   

On the project I did about 6 yrs ago I hired a bunch of laborers to manually bag the rocks and it was quite labor intensive.    Has anyone done this using some kind of vacuum system?   I am hoping there is a better way.   

Also - Any other racking suggestions other than SolarDock for this application?
